The French New Wave involved a group of film critics turned filmmakers during the 50s, 60s and 70s. These filmmakers were Francois Truffaut, Jean-Luc Godard, Claude Chabrol, Eric Rohmer, Jacques Rivette, Louis Malle, Alain Resnais, Agnes Varda and Jacques Demy. Between them they created hundreds of films including: Jules et Jim, Eyes without a Face and Les Quatre Cents Coups. The filmmakers showed that they didn't need mainstream studios but that they could make great films on their own. The French New Wave also demonstrated technological changes to film such as long takes, jump cuts and shooting outdoors. They were able to do this because they had smaller handheld cameras which made it much easier to film.
This was very important to the development of TV and film as it made cinema an important art form that people previously thought was for the lower class and failed theatre actors. Although it can no longer be considered 'new' the impact of these directors and their films are still very important. In many was they were the leaders in a new style of film.
